Our last breakfast at the Lodge. Having decided that five nights are too much as the Lodge is a bit isolated. So off to Khao Lak, this is a beach resort around one and a half hours away. The Dame has pre booked a driver from Khao Lak to pick us up from the Lodge, his name is Alex. Alex arrives at 10.30 we say our goodbyes to Mr Manager, to be fair he did well in the end getting some nice gluten free bread and cakes. The bread mix was called “Yes You Can” from Australia.

Alex stops at a view point, today is a little cloudy so not the best for photography, but still stunning craggy limestone karsts way into the distance,

During the journey Alex tries to get us to sign up for one of his excursions, we’ll give it some thought. Arrive at Oasis Khao Lok resort, after a good journey Alex is a very careful driver. There are eighteen individual chalets around a central swimming pool, nice and modern. They offer free transport to the beach and main town. Off to Khao Lok main town. We wait by the road for a songthaew here they call them taxis,but they all wizz by.

One on the opposite side stops and then attempts to turn round. He pulls up Khao town please, he doesn’t seeem to understand. “Ah Khao town is other way, but he will take us, the other thing here they have a set price, which is 150 Bhat. Now he has the problem over turning against the traffic, which takes about 10 mins. The Duke needs another pair of reading glasses, at this rate our holiday money will be spent of glasses, but luckily they are only 200 Bhat.

We manage to get a taxi to agree 100 to take us to the night market. It is a busy place lots of stalls with food and drink and of course all the clothing.

You can get a cocktail for 90 but is there any alcohol in it, then we spotted. A Nice cocktail stall with good music and a professional cocktail shaker, well that what the Dame called him, I think she liked his moves. Excellent Mojito’s, here 150 baht ( £4) A walk around the market and then some dinner at another stall hard to choose from the many selling cheap food that looks good.
